UNCG's Dougherty named SoCon Player of the Week
SPARTANBURG, SC – UNC Greensboro freshman
Lucy Dougherty has been named Southern Conference Women's
Tennis Player of the Week for all matches from March 2-8, the
league office announced Wednesday.
Dougherty went 3-0 at No. 5 singles last week and was 3-0 in
doubles play as the Spartans downed Wyoming (6-1), Air Force (4-3)
and Northern Colorado (5-2). The Player of the Week award is
voted on by the league's sports information directors.
The Melbourne, Australia, native picked up wins over
Wyoming's Jamie Nelson (6-2, 6-3), Air Force's Samantha
Sarkis (6-3, 1-6, 6-4) and Northern Colorado's Jodi Ciarvella
(6-2, 6-2) at No. 5 singles where she is 4-0 this season.
Dougherty, who helped the Spartans run their win streak to four,
also picked up three wins at No. 2 doubles with Valerie Behr.
Dougherty and Behr have now won each of their last four matches as
doubles partners.
